One of New Orleans' venerable Mardi Gras Indian tribes (actually African-American), The Wild Magnolias perform and record only sporadically, but when they do it's always a funky party. The Pine Leaf Boys are a new generation of Cajun musicians from Louisiana who not only grew up with the music but live and breathe it. They play authentic, traditional Cajun, Creole and zydeco music while adding some updates of their own. The group is famous for its hard-driving approach to Cajun music that had one Boston Globe reviewer comparing them to the irresistible jazz swing of Django Reinhardt. The core group membership is Balfa (guitar, vocals), Dirk Powell (accordion) and Courtney Granger (vocals, fiddle).
